Abstract

Peptic ulcer is a ceaseless sickness influencing up to 10% of the total population. Peptic ulcer created by the unevenness of gastric juice pH and mucosal protections. Two fundamental components delivered Peptic ulcer. Frist is central point it included bacterial disease, for example, Helicobacter Pylori (H. Pylori) and medicine non-steroidal anti-inflammatory medication and synthetic E.g., HCL, Ethanol. Second is minor factor it included pressure, smoking, fiery food and nourishment lopsidedness. Ordinary treatment of Peptic ulcer, for example, proton siphon inhibitor (PPI) and Histamine-2 (H2) Receptor Antagonist. Also, other Hand therapeutic plant and their concoction compound are valuable in the counteraction and treatment of peptic ulcer infection. Various creature models are utilizing to influenced ulcer to identifying the antiulcer activity of many new existed drugs such as Pylorus ligated (shay) rats, Stress ulcers, Restraint ulcer in rats, Water immersion-induced restraint ulcers, Cold and restraint ulcers, Gastric mucosal damage induced by NSAID in rats, Induced solitary chronic gastric ulcer, Acetic acid induced kissing gastric ulcers in rats Histamine induced gastric ulcer in guinea pig, Duodenal anti-ulcer activity, Gastric cytoprotective action.
